117. Use of experts and consultants in the United Nations

The General Assembly, Recalling its decision of 18 December 1974, taken at its twenty-ninth session,[1] by which it outlined principles and guidelines on the use of experts and consultants in the United Nations, Recalling further its decision of 17 December 1975, taken at its thirtieth session,[2] as well as its resolutions 31/205 of 22 December 1976 and 32/203 of 21 December 1977, in which it reaffirmed the aforesaid principles and guidelines and called for their full and effective implementation, Taking note of the report of the Secretary-General[3]4and the related oral report of the Advisory Committee on Administrative and Budgetary Questions,[4] Expressing the view that the comparative data contained in the report of the Secretary-General does not permit the General Assembly to determine whether the existing deficiencies have been corrected or to ascertain fully the status of implementation of the principles and guidelines set by the Assembly, Taking note of the assurances of the Secretary-General contained in paragraph 22 of his report and those of his representative at the 9th meeting of the Fifth Committee, on 5 October 1978,[5]

1. Calls upon the Secretary-General to eliminate the present deficiencies in the implementation of the principles and guidelines on the use of experts and consultants and to improve upon the existing procedures, so that a proper evaluation of the existing practice in this regard can be carried out;

2. Requests the Secretary-General to submit to the General Assembly at its thirty-fifth session a full and comprehensive report on the implementation of the principles and guidelines set by the Assembly;

3. Further requests the Secretary-General to take into account the views expressed by Member States during the consideration of this item when implementing the principles and guidelines on the use of experts and consultants.

88th plenary meeting
19 December 1978
